
Five players: Liverpool’s
Victor Moses, Dynomo Kiev’s Brown Ideye, Fenerbhce’s Emmanuel Emenike,
Real Betis’ Nosa Igiebor and Newcastle’s Shola Ameobi were absent from
training..
But spokesman for the Eagles Ben Alaiya told
correspondent via the telephone that Moses, Ideye, Igiebor and Emenike
were expected to arrive at the camp late in the evening.“Only Ameobi got permission to report to camp on Wednesday,” Alaiya said.
“The Secretary of the team, Dayo Enebi, said Ameobi had a flight hitch and he is expected to arrive in the country on Wednesday morning.”
The players who trained on Tuesday are Vincent Enyeama, Austin Ejide, Chigozie Agbim, Efe Ambrose, Elderson Echejile and Godfrey Oboabona.
Others are Azubuike Egwuekwe, Solomon Kwambe, Benjamin Francis, James Okwuosa, Mikel, Ogenyi Onazi, John Ogu, Sunday Mba, Nnamdi Oduamadi,Uche Nwofor, Obinna Nsofor and Ahmed Musa.
The Eagles, who are scheduled to travel to Addis Ababa on Saturday, will train again at the same venue on Wednesday afternoon.
